Jamshedpur: Due to yard remodelling at Santragachi station in the Kharagpur Division, a series of Non-Interlocking (NI) works will take place, leading to significant train service disruptions. The pre-NI work will span 13 days from April 30, 2025, to May 12, 2025, followed by five days of additional pre-NI work from May 13, 2025, to May 17, 2025. This will culminate in a seven-hour complete traffic block on May 18, 2025, affecting train operations in the Howrah-Kharagpur (HWH-KGP) section.
As a result, several Mail/Express trains will be canceled on specific dates. Some of the notable cancellations include the 22804 SBP-SHM Express on May 2, 2025 and its return journey, 22803 SHM-SBP Express, on May 3, 2025. Similarly, the 18049 SHM-BMPR Express and 18050 BMPR-SHM Express will be canceled on May 3-4 and again on May 17-18, 2025. Other affected trains include the 18051/18052 BMPR-ROU-BMPR Express (May 4 and 18), 12888 PURI-SHM Weekly Express (May 4) and 12887 SHM-PURI Weekly Express (May 5). The 12883/12884 SRC-PRR-HWH Rupashi Bangla Express will face cancellations on May 5, 17 and 18.
Additionally, several special and long-distance trains will not operate during this period. These include the 08508 VSKP-SHM TOD Special (May 6) and 08507 SHM-VSKP TOD Special (May 7), along with the 20832 SBP-SHM Mahima Gosain Express (May 6) and its return 20831 SHM-SBP Mahima Gosain Express (May 7). The PURI-HWH Shatabdi Express (12277/12278) will be canceled on May 11. Other weekly services like 20971 UDZ-SHM and 20972 SHM-UDZ will not operate on May 10 and 11, respectively.
Further disruptions include cancellations of trains such as 12949 PBR-SRC Kavi Guru Express (May 9) and 12950 SRC-PBR Kavi Guru Express (May 11), as well as 18033/18034 HWH-GTS-HWH MEMU (May 11). The 22897 HWH-DGHA Kandari Express and 12858 DGHA-HWH Tamralipta Express will be affected on May 11. Other impacted services include 06081 KCVL-SHM TOD Express (May 9) and 06082 SHM-KCVL TOD Express (May 12). Several Howrah-bound express trains such as 18011/18012 HWH-CKP (May 10, 17) and 18013/18014 HWH-BKSC (May 10, 17) will also be canceled. The 18615/18616 HWH-HTE Kriya Yoga Express and 12837/12838 HWH-PURI Express will not operate on May 11 and 17.
Several trains will also be rescheduled due to the work. The 12885 SHM-BJE Aranyak Express will depart one hour late on May 3 and 7, while the 22214 PNBE-SHM Duronto Express will be delayed by three hours on May 6 and 17. Other notable reschedulings include the 12101 LTT-SHM Express (delayed by four hours on May 16), 12129 PUNE-HWH Express (four-hour delay on May 16) and 12809 CSMT-HWH Mail (2.5-hour delay on May 16). Similarly, the 12949 PBR-SRC Kavi Guru Express will run two hours late on May 16. Local services such as 38807 HWH-MDN EMU will be delayed by 30 minutes on May 11 and 17.
A total of 15 express trains and several suburban trains will also face short termination or short origination. EMU and local train services will also be affected, with some services canceled altogether. These disruptions are expected to impact passengers traveling in the Howrah-Kharagpur section during this period.
